Kimbo Aroma Gold Whole Bean Coffee is a premium Italian blend crafted entirely from Arabica beans. Known for its smooth flavor and moderate caffeine strength, it is roasted in Naples, Italy, where Kimbo has built its reputation for authentic espresso.

What is Kimbo Aroma Gold?

Kimbo Aroma Gold is a 100% Arabica coffee blend designed to highlight the natural sweetness and aromatic complexity of Arabica beans. Unlike blends that include Robusta for strength, Aroma Gold focuses on smoothness and balance.

  • Origin: Central and South America, regions known for high‑quality Arabica.
  • Roast Level: Medium‑dark, intensity rating of 9/13.
  • Blend: 100% Arabica beans, no Robusta.
  • Purpose: Ideal for espresso, moka pot, French press, and drip brewing.
  • Packaging: Available in 500 g and 1 kg bags with freshness seals.

Together, these traits make Aroma Gold one of Kimbo’s most refined offerings. It appeals to coffee lovers who value aroma, smoothness, and elegance over sheer strength.

Flavor Profile and Roast Level of Kimbo Aroma Gold

The flavor is smooth and balanced, with notes of chocolate, toasted nuts, and subtle floral undertones that reflect its Central and South American origins. Unlike lighter roasts that emphasize fruitiness and acidity, Aroma Gold’s roast level reduces sharpness, creating a low‑acidity cup with a velvety mouthfeel.

  • Chocolate Notes: Rich undertones of dark chocolate.
  • Nutty Aroma: Subtle hints of almond and baked goods.
  • Body: Full‑bodied yet smooth and balanced.
  • Acidity: Mild, with a clean finish.
  • Crema: Dense and golden when brewed as espresso.

This flavor profile makes Aroma Gold versatile—it works well as espresso but also shines in drip or French press brewing.

Caffeine in Kimbo Aroma Gold Coffee by Cup Size

The caffeine content in Kimbo Aroma Gold Whole Bean Coffee depends largely on the serving size and brewing method. Since Aroma Gold is made from 100% Arabica beans, its caffeine levels are moderate compared to blends that include Robusta.

  • 8 oz cup (240 ml): 95–120 mg caffeine.
  • 12 oz cup (355 ml): 140–160 mg caffeine.
  • 16 oz cup (475 ml): 180–200 mg caffeine.
  • 20 oz cup (590 ml): 220–240 mg caffeine.

Aroma Gold provides steady energy without overwhelming intensity, making it suitable for multiple cups throughout the day.

Caffeine in Kimbo Aroma Gold Coffee by Espresso Shot

Arabica beans naturally contain less caffeine than Robusta, but when brewed under pressure in espresso form, the caffeine concentration per milliliter is still significant.

  • Single shot (30 ml): 60–70 mg caffeine.
  • Double shot (60 ml): 120–140 mg caffeine.
  • Ristretto (20 ml): 45–50 mg caffeine.
  • Lungo (50–70 ml): 80–100 mg caffeine.

Aroma Gold espresso shots are smooth and balanced, offering energy without excessive stimulation.

Factors That Influence Caffeine Levels in Kimbo Aroma Gold Coffee

While the beans themselves are 100% Arabica, which naturally contain less caffeine than Robusta, the way you grind, brew, and serve the coffee can significantly change how much caffeine ends up in your cup.

  • Grind Size: Finer grinds extract more caffeine.
  • Brewing Method: Espresso yields higher concentration than drip.
  • Water Temperature: Hotter water extracts caffeine faster.
  • Serving Size: Larger cups increase total caffeine.
  • Bean Type: 100% Arabica means moderate caffeine compared to blends with Robusta.

Aroma Gold’s caffeine strength depends on brewing technique, grind, and serving size. Its Arabica base ensures smoother flavor and moderate caffeine compared to stronger blends.
